Action of photosynthetic diuron herbicide on cell organelles and biochemical constituents of the leaves of two soybean cultivars
Two varieties of soybean (_Glycine max_ L. cv. Clark and Crawford) showed a high sensitivity to low concentrations of diuron herbicide [3-(3,4-dichlorophenyl)-1,1-dimethyl urea]. Depending on the application dose of diuron, chlorosis, necrosis, and wilting of leaves ending in death after 7 to 10 days were observed.
